How Do You Shave A Layer Off A Pumpkin?

Using the rotary pumpkin-carving tool or a wood-carving tool, slowly shave off the top layer of the pumpkin’s skin between the taped lines. Continue from top to bottom until all that remains of the pumpkin’s skin are the areas that were protected by tape. Carefully remove the tape.

How do you peel the skin off a pumpkin?

Poke the squash or pumpkin all over with the tines of a fork. Place it in a microwave-safe dish and microwave on high for 3 minutes. Use a paring knife or Y-shaped peeler to remove the skin. It will practically fall off in large strips.

How deep do you shave a pumpkin?

Shaving a Pumpkin
You can use these to “shave” the areas that are white in you image. Same concept as before, but instead of cutting through the pumpkin, carve ½” – 1″ deep & scoop away the pumpkin flesh as evenly as you can!

Do pumpkins need to be peeled?

Depending on what type of squash you are using you might not need to peel it, with thinner skinned squash such as butternut squash you can eat the skin. For thicker skinned squash it is often easier to cut the squash into large wedges, roast, and then peel the skin off after it’s cooked when it’s softer and easier.

How long do shaved pumpkins last?

Once carved, pumpkins will generally only hold up for three to five days — or up to two weeks if you live in a colder climate — before wilting and showing signs of decay. And that’s not very long when you’ve worked so hard on your masterpiece.

Do you clean out pumpkin before carving?

Even if you’re not eating a pumpkin, you should inspect and clean it before carving. You want your pumpkin to be clean before you handle it for carving. Remove any mushy or moldy spots on the pumpkin with a knife. Rub the pumpkin down with a vegetable brush or a clean, rough cloth.

How do you hollow out a pumpkin?

Using a pumpkin saw—you can find one in any pumpkin carving set—cut a circle around the bottom of the pumpkin that measures at least 4 inches across. Once you complete the cut around the entire circle, gently move the cut piece back and forth to loosen it from the pumpkin. Remove the cut-out piece and discard.

How do you make a pumpkin easier to cut?

Bake or microwave it
For all large, difficult-to-cut squash and pumpkins (or a recipe where you’re keeping the squash mostly whole, like this one), giving the whole thing a quick zap in the microwave or the oven is an insanely easy trick for softening the skin just enough to make cutting easier.
